Hey guys I have been doing alot of research about properly adjusting the tps and there seems to be alot of different information regarding tps voltages on the net.
My car has a 96 JDM type r with the matching JDM p73 ecu. It seems to be running rich and I have changed just about every sensor including O2. with no luck. I know the TPS was tampered with by the previous owner so this is my only luck!
Can anyone veryify what the voltage is supposed to be at idle and at WOT? I would prefer if someone that had this motor/ecu could could possibly check theirs?
Most websites state .48-.5v at idle and 4.5v at wot. But others have stated differently with some people trying to set their tps to this and their car did not run properly until lowering the idle voltage to .32v
